1.The diagnostic value of multi-planar reconstruction in semicircular canals disease by HRCT.
Jianji ZHANG ; Xiaowei SUN ; Yuanping DING ; Fenfen DOU ; Yinghui JIANG ; Hanbing ZHANG ; Anting XU
Journal of Clinical Otorhinolaryngology Head and Neck Surgery 2008;22(22):1011-1013
OBJECTIVE:
To study the diagnostic value of high-resolution computed tomography (HRCT) and multiplanar reconstruction (MPR) in assessment of semicircular canals disease.
METHOD:
Eighty-three patients were scanned with HRCT and the original data were processed with MPR. The semicircular canals full length was respectively observed in one image of MPR in the normal ears. The abnormal location of the canal were observed.
RESULT:
In one image the full length of the horizontal, superior and posterior semicircular canal can be respectively displayed in one image of MPR in normal ears. By this way ,1 superior semicircular canal dehiscence (SSCD)was found in precaution group, 1 superior and 2 horizontal semicircular canal blocked, 1 vestibular aqueduct (VA) joined into superior semicircular canal and 2 VAs joined into posterior semicircular canal and abnormity of the three semicircular canals were found in SNHL.
CONCLUSION
MPR canould display the three canals full length in one picture and have a high specificity in the diagnosis of the semicircular canal abnormity.

2.Diagnostic value of high-resolution computed tomography imaging in congenital inner ear malformations.
Xiaowei SUN ; Yuanping DING ; Jianji ZHANG ; Ying CHEN ; Anting XU ; Fenfen DOU ; Zihe ZHANG
Journal of Clinical Otorhinolaryngology Head and Neck Surgery 2007;21(4):154-156
OBJECTIVE:
To observe the inner ear structure with volume rendering (VR) reconstruction and to evaluate the role of high-resolution computed tomography (HRCT) in congenital inner ear malformations.
METHOD:
HRCT scanning was performed in 10 patients (20 ears) without ear disease (control group) and 7 patients (11 ears) with inner ear malformations (IEM group) and the original data was processed with VR reconstruction. The inner ear osseous labyrinth structure in the images generated by these techniques was observed respectively in the normal ears and malformation ears.
RESULT:
The inner ear osseous labyrinth structure and the relationship was displayed clearly in VR imaging in the control group,meanwhile, characters and degree of malformed structure were also displayed clearly in the IEA group. Of seven patients (11 ears) with congenital inner ear malformations, the axial, MPR and VR images can display the site and degree in 9 ears. VR images were superior to the axial images in displaying the malformations in 2 ears with the small lateral semicircular canal malformations. The malformations included Mondini deformity (7 ears), vestibular and semicircular canal malformations (3 ears), vestibular aqueduct dilate (7 ears, of which 6 ears accompanied by other malformations) , the internal auditory canal malformation (2 ears, all accompanied by other malformations).
CONCLUSION
HRCT can display the normal structure of bone inner ear through high quality VR reconstructions. VR images can also display the site and degree of the malformations three-dimensionally and intuitively. HRCT is valuable in diagnosing the inner ear malformation.

3.Expression and significance of nuclear factor-kappa B ligand and correlation factor in the tissue of otitis media with cholesteatoma.
Ming XIA ; Shouling DING ; Hanbing ZHANG ; Fang LIU ; Haiying YIN ; Anting XU
Journal of Clinical Otorhinolaryngology Head and Neck Surgery 2007;21(7):315-317
OBJECTIVE:
To investigate the expressions of nuclear factor-kappa B ligand (RANKL), receptor activator of nuclear factor-kappa B(RANK)and osteoprotegerin (OPG) and the relation of RANKL with bone- erosion in human cholesteatoma tissue.
METHOD:
Thirty cholesteatoma and twenty normal auditory canal skin specimens were investigated. The expressions of RANKL, RANK and OPG were examined by immunohistochemistry.
RESULT:
The overexpressions of the cytokine RANKL and RANK were found in infiltrated lymphocytes in the cholesteatoma tissue comparing with normal external meatal skin( t = 7. 758,6. 482, P <0. 05); While, the expression of OPG was significantly higher in cholesteatoma tissue comparing with normal external meatal skin. the OPG/ RANKL was decreased in cholesteatoma tissue comparing with normal external meatal skin( t = 8. 183, P < 0. 05).
CONCLUSION
This study revealed that the expressions level of RANKL and RANK were markedly increased in the perimatrix of cholesteatoma, which is closely related to the bone- erosion induced by cholesteatoma.

4.Risk factors associated with hypoglycemia in patients with type 2 diabetes mellitus: a community based case-control study
Xu LI ; Jigang YUAN ; Zhangying LUO ; Yan WANG ; Hui XU ; Zhiping SHEN ; Jue LI ; Lijuan ZHANG
Shanghai Journal of Preventive Medicine 2022;34(4):366-370
ObjectiveTo determine the risk factors associated with hypoglycemia in community patients with type 2 diabetes mellitus(T2DM). MethodsA case-control study was performed among 914 patients with T2DM and no medical history of hypoglycemia were selected in the Diabetes Unit of Tongji University School of Medicine Affiliated Anting Community Health Center in 2018. A total of 196 patients with T2DM who had ≥1 hypoglycemia event in the past 12 months were presented as the case group, and 718 patients who did not have any hypoglycemia event during the same period were included as the control group. Medical history, medication, life style, and related factors were collected. Multivariate logistic regression analysis was used to determine the risk factors associated with hypoglycemia. ResultsHistory of coronary heart disease [adjusted odds ratio(aOR)=2.077, 95% CI: 1.293-3.337], renal disease (aOR=4.775, 95% CI: 1.537-14.830), and previous insulin use (aOR =1.765, 95%CI: 1.147-2.716) significantly increased the risk of hypoglycemia, while angiotensin converting enzyme inhibitors(ACEI)(aOR =0.127, 95%CI: 0.044-0.366) and β-receptor blockers (aOR =0.271, 95%CI: 0.119-0.616) decreased the risk of hypoglycemia among diabetic patients. ConclusionIncidence of hypoglycemia in community patients with diabetes is high. History of coronary heart disease and kidney disease, and previous insulin use may increase the risk of hypoglycemia, which warrants further attention by community general practitioners.

6.Effects of canthaxanthin in increasing reproductive hormone secretion through re-ducing ovarian oxidative stress injury on egg production rate of Huaixiang chickens
Zhuo SUN ; Tingting XIE ; Zhuangzhi ZHAO ; Junwen ZHAO ; Anting ZHANG ; Jiang WU ; Mei XIAO ; Lilong AN
Chinese Journal of Veterinary Science 2024;44(10):2266-2276
A total of 360 healthy 26 week old Huaixiang hens were randomly divided into 10 groups,of which,five groups were reared at normal temperature(NC,NT1,NT2,NT3,NT4)and other five groups were reared at high temperature(HC,HT1,HT2,HT3,HT4),all chickens were feed with 0,4,6,8,10 mg/kg canthaxanthin(CX)respectively.The pre-test period was 2 weeks and the main test period was 9 weeks.The results showed that high temperature reduced the egg pro-duction rate(P<0.05),led to damage and hemorrhage in the ovaries,decreased the activity of su-peroxide dismutase(SOD),glutathione peroxidase(GSH-Px)in the serum and the ovaries(P<0.05),decreased the levels of FSH,LH,P4,and E2(P<0.05),decreased the expression of FSHR,LHR,ER,and PR(P<0.05),and increased the levels of malonaldehyde(MDA)(P<0.05)in the ovaries.Addition of CX increased the egg production rate(P<0.05),increased the activity of serum and ovarian SOD and GSH-Px enzymes(P<0.05),decreased the content of serum and ovarian MDA(P<0.05)),increased the ovarian levels of FSH,LH,P4,E2(P<0.05),and increased the o-varian expression of FSHR,LHR,ER,and PR(P<0.05)in Huaixiang chickens at normal and high temperature environmental conditions,respectively.Among them,the highest egg production rate,the strongest antioxidant capacity of serum and ovarian tissues,the best integrity of ovarian tis-sues,ovarian reproductive hormone secretion and expression of reproductive hormone receptors were observed in Huaixiang chickens when 6 mg/kg of CX was added to the diet under normal temperature and when 8 mg/kg CX was added to the diet under high temperature conditions.The results showed that under normal and high temperature conditions,adding CX to the diet signifi-cantly increased the antioxidant capacity of serum and ovaries,alleviated the damage of ovary,pro-moted the secretion of reproductive hormone and the expression of reproductive hormone recep-tors,and increased egg production rate.Dietary supplemented with CX could not restore the dam-age and repair of ovarian tissue,the secretion of reproductive hormone and receptor to normal tem-perature level.The effects of CX on egg production rate,ovarian tissue structure,reproductive hor-mone and receptor expression in chickens were affected by the environmental temperature.When the egg production rate,antioxidant capacity of ovarian tissues,reproductive hormone levels and receptor expression of Huaixiang chickens were optimal,the amount of CX in high temperature en-vironment was more than that of the dose in normal temperature environment.
7.Epidemiological characteristics of Class A and B infectious diseases in Jiading District of Shanghai, 2014-2019
Long ZHANG ; Huifang JI ; Yanqing QIU ; Lixin XU
Journal of Public Health and Preventive Medicine 2020;31(3):99-103
Objective To analyze the incidence and epidemic characteristics of Class A and B infectious diseases in Jiading District of Shanghai from 2014 to 2019,understand the prevention and control effects of infectious diseases in recent years,and provide a reference for the formulation of future prevention and control strategies and measures for infectious diseases. Methods According to the " China Disease Prevention and Control Information System",statistical analysis was conducted on the data of Class A and B infectious diseases in Jiading District of Shanghai from 2014 to 2019. Results A total of 11 862 cases of Class A and B infectious diseases were reported in Jiading District of Shanghai from 2014 to 2019,with an average annual incidence rate of 127.34/100000. The overall reported incidence rate showed a downward trend (χ2=36.354,P =0.000<0.05) .The top five infectious diseases with an average annual incidence were syphilis,gonorrhea,tuberculosis,scarlet fever,and hepatitis B.The incidence rate in the central area of Jiading District was high over the years,and the incidence rate in the north and south was low.The incidence of males was higher than that of females,and the difference was statistically significant (χ2=818.269,P=0.000<0.05) .The high incidence age was 5- years old, followed by 20- years old. The top three occupations in terms of morbidity were workers, housework, unemployed,and retired.In terms of onset time,December and May-June were the two peak periods; February was the trough.Conclusion Class A and B infectious diseases in Jiading District of Shanghai showed a downward trend from 2014to 2019. Blood-borne and sexually transmitted infections and respiratory infectious diseases are still infectious diseases that need to be focused on prevention and control,mainly syphilis,gonorrhea and tuberculosis. Targeted prevention measures should be formulated in conjunction with peak onset times and key populations to further reduce the incidence of Class A and B infectious diseases.
8.Research Progress on Mechanisms of Vibration in Osteogenesis of Bone Mesenchymal Stem Cells
Anting JIN ; Peng ZHANG ; Yiling YANG ; Lingyong JIANG
Journal of Medical Biomechanics 2019;34(4):E440-E445
Vibration represents a micro reciprocating motion of a particle or object along a line or arc relative to a reference position, while the effect of low-magnitude high-frequency vibration (LMHFV) on skeletal system cells is similar to the mechanical stimulation of muscle movement. Bone mesenchymal stem cells (BMSCs), which have been identified as force-sensitive cells, exist in the bone marrows and have the potential of multi-lineage differentiation. Their biological characteristics can change functionally according to the appropriate stimulation in vitro, in order to reach the optimal demand of the stimulation. LMHFV can promote the osteogenic differentiation of BMSCs, therefore, the research on its mechanism can contribute to the application of vibration in the treatment of diseases such as osteoporosis, fracture, osteogenesis imperfecta, obesity as well as the promotion of orthodontic tooth movement. This paper summarizes the recent progress about the effects of vibration on BMSCs stem cells in osteogenesis and the possible mechanisms, so as to provide research ideas and methods for studying the mechanical as well as biological changes of BMSCs under vibration stimulation.

10. In vitro study on signal transduction in mice spiral ganglion cell stimulated by multi-wavelength laser based on calcium imaging
Na WANG ; Xinyu HUO ; Anting XU ; Chengcheng LIU ; Xiulin ZHANG ; Ming ZENG ; Lan TIAN
Chinese Journal of Otorhinolaryngology Head and Neck Surgery 2020;55(2):133-138
Objective:
To research the auditory nerve transduction effects under multi-wavelength pulsed laser stimulations within a safe and acceptable signal range.
Methods:
The real-time detection of intracellular calcium concentration was adopted by specific fluorescent indicator staining based on calcium imager. The spiral ganglion cells of mice were cultured in vitro. After fluorescent indicating, morphologic observation under optical microscope, Fura-2 calcium ion fluorescence excitation, intact morphology cells selection, fixing the optical fiber, the spiral ganglion cells were irradiated by different wavelength laser, including visible light (450 nm) and near infrared light (808 nm,1 065 nm). The intracellular calcium concentration was monitored by calcium ion imaging.
Results:
When 450 nm laser stimulated spiral ganglion cells, the intracellular calcium concentration was strongly increased, however, for other wavelength laser stimulation, there was no obvious relative response. And the sensitivity expression of the nerve cells under laser was related with the location of laser fiber. Cells closer to the fiber produced more obvious changes in calcium ion concentration, while for cells farther away from the fiber, the change amplitudes were weaker although the number of changes in calcium ion concentration was consistent.
Conclusion
The spiral ganglion cells of mice can induce a signal transduction response under the action of laser, and the response has laser wavelength selectivity.
